Below are some photos of a task I did to repair roof covering rot on my fifth wheel camper. I chose to utilize this approach because I could do it myself with my very own resources and abilities. Otherwise, a lot of equipment, including the ladder and roofing shelf, the endcap and the filon external wall surface would certainly have had to be torn apart.
In reality, I prefer it in this manner since I understand just how the solution was done. Plus, I would have had to get it out, possibly costing me thousands of bucks. I used items from The Rot Doctor. I have no association with the company. They were extremely practical in discussing my options and in clarifying the methods to used their items.
I utilized a box knife to cut the rubber roof covering in the edge. It possibly leaked from the time the unit was brand-new, as the roofing system was extremely soft in this edge, and we have actually been in dry spell conditions for 2 years.
Folding back the rubber revealed the rotten area. I cut an item of plywood like a puzzle to match the shape of the opening I made in the roofing system.
Here's the sprayer I used to use the CPES * from The Rot Doctor. With its 18 steel "stick" I can penetrate right into the 2 area between the roofing and the ceiling.
6. Here's the finished roofing system sealed up with Eternabond tape. I ran a strip of Eternabond all the means across the camper where the roof covering meets the endcap. Any type of fears of a leak here are a distant memory. 7. I additionally had rot in the wall straight below the area on the roofing system.
I extensively dried the location for numerous days using the exhaust side of a small vacuum cleaner, placing the hose between the internal and outer wall surfaces. When it was thoroughly dry I covered everything with CPES *, making use of the insect sprayer to permeate right into otherwise hard to reach areas.
Keep in mind the leading 3-4 of the stud was totally rotted away. I spread out Fill-It Epoxy Filler * throughout the area. The things goes on like a thick and sticky gel, then dries to a really difficult product that bonds to the CPES * I had actually splashed onto the timber.

Resealing your RV roof covering is a workable DIY project if you take it detailed. Right here's a streamlined overview:: Inspect your roofing for fractures, old sealant, and damage. Tidy the whole roof covering surface utilizing a recreational vehicle roofing cleaner and a scrub brush.
: Carefully eliminate any type of failing or cracked sealant around vents, skylights, and joints using a plastic scraper or specialized sealer removal device. Beware not to harm the roof material.: Utilizing a self-leveling sealant (especially designed for motor home roofs), apply a generous bead along all joints, around vents, skylights, and any various other roofing system penetrations.
: If you have splits or damages, consider making use of RV roof covering repair service tape or a liquid rubber covering, adhering to the item directions carefully.: Once the sealer has treated (check item guidelines for healing time), examine the whole roofing system to make sure all locations are properly sealed.: Constantly consult the details directions for your sealer and repair items.

To figure out whether your motor home roof covering is constructed from EPDM or TPO, comply with these steps:: Discover a roofing system vent on your RV.: Unscrew and take off the trim ring to expose a section of the roof covering material.: Ideally, get rid of a staple from the roofing product and analyze both sides: If one side is white or dove gray with a black support, it is likely EPDM.
The primary distinction between RV roofing sealant and covering is their purpose and application.: This is generally used to fill gaps, seams, and cracks in the roof material. It offers a water resistant barrier to stop leakages and is typically used in specific areas, such as around vents, joints, and various other infiltrations.
: This is a safety layer that covers the entire roof covering surface. Coatings are generally used to enhance UV resistance, reflectivity, and general roof toughness. They can aid prolong the life of the roof product by providing an additional obstacle against climate components. Both products are essential for keeping a RV roofing system however serve distinct functions, ensuring its durability and efficiency.

We attempt to plan our paths thoroughly to avoid low-hanging items over the roadway. Sometimes, though, we discover ourselves in unexpected situations. This is how we wound up with a few tiny splits on the roofing system of our motor home.
We thought we were free from the branches, however we finished up catching a few of them on the far left side of the roof. There were an overall of 4-5 small holes in the side of the roof covering. We really did not examine the roof covering because we didn't think we hit anything.
Among the tears in our recreational vehicle roof A few weeks later, we sustained a severe electrical storm and a LOT of rainfall. During the storm, we found that we had a tiny quantity of water dripping via among the light components in the restroom. Thankfully, we did not wind up with any long-term water damages.
He covered it as ideal he can with sturdy gorilla tape and after that ordered the products needed to do a RV roof covering repair work. The EPDM rubber roof product that the majority of Recreational vehicles include is usually rather tough as for roofing materials go (Villa Park Rv Roof Repair Fiberglass). Rubber roof coverings last for many years, yet they do tear if captured hard enough
In our situation, this indicated eliminating the gorilla tape that we had utilized as a momentary fix while we waited on the products we got to arrive. You'll wish to clean up the area around the tear that you will certainly be covering well. This permits the spot to effectively adhere and will certainly stop future leaks.
To clean up the roofing, make use of rubbing alcohol and either a dustcloth or paper towels. Tucker discussed the location 2-3 times to see to it it was cleaned up actually well. Let it completely dry totally prior to carrying on. Applying the Externabond tape After the area has actually extensively dried out from cleansing, it's time to add the Eternabond tape, which is a RV roofing repair tape.
